Not sure if this is on purpose but this commit doesn't seem to have a
commit message. If you'd like some extra context to write it, I ran into
cyclic includes when writing the original version (which you found and
fixed). Since I am not familiar with the rest of the code, a new file
seemed like a good enough hack to get things working. Now that you
solved the cyclic includes, it makes sense to remove the files.
